Arjun spends his days guiding tourists and driving a bus in the dunes of Jaisalmer, but his true ambition is to become a celebrated singer. When he meets tourist Naina Dixit, his heartfelt performance wins her admiration, and she urges him to travel to Bombay and try his talent in the big city, hoping he can finally fulfill his dream.

The story begins in Jaisalmer, a desert town in Rajasthan where Arjun works as a guide and bus driver. He later travels to Bombay, the metropolis of dreams, where his singing career takes off. The contrast between the calm, humble desert setting and the bustling city of Bombay frames his journey from small-town dreamer to big-city star.
Jaisalmer is portrayed as a humble desert town known for tourism and desert safaris. Arjun earns his living guiding tourists and driving a bus through the dunes. It represents his roots and the simple life he leaves behind, serving as the starting point for his dreams of becoming a professional singer.
Bombay is depicted as the city of dreams where aspiring artists go to find success. It represents opportunity, ambition, and the music industry. The city's fast-paced, competitive environment contrasts sharply with Jaisalmer's tranquility, and it's where Arjun's talent is discovered, developed, and eventually celebrated.
The film explores fame as both an opportunity and a test. Arjun's rapid rise from bus driver to celebrated singer shows how sudden success can transform one's life. However, fame also brings pressure, creates obsession in others, and strains personal relationships. The movie examines whether achieving your dream is worth the cost.
The love triangle between Arjun, Naina, and Bobby drives much of the emotional conflict. Naina provides steady, grounding support while Bobby's feelings become possessive and controlling. This romantic tension tests loyalties and creates danger, showing how fame can complicate personal relationships and bring out darker emotions in people.
Arjun's path to success is guided by several supporters: Naina encourages him to pursue his dreams, Bobby funds his recording project, and Gujral provides the business backing. The film emphasizes that artistic success rarely happens alone and highlights the importance of mentorship, community, and loyalty in achieving one's goals.
Arjun Singh is a humble guide and bus driver from Jaisalmer who harbors dreams of becoming a celebrated singer. Despite his simple origins, he possesses genuine talent and ambition. His journey involves leaving his family to pursue stardom in Bombay, where his talent is discovered and developed with help from various backers.
Naina Dixit is a tourist who first witnesses Arjun's singing talent during an open-air performance in Jaisalmer. She becomes his steady source of encouragement, urging him to try his luck in Bombay and later welcoming him into her home. Her unconditional support represents the healthy, nurturing side of love and friendship.
Bobby Gujral is a wealthy, ambitious young woman who recognizes Arjun's potential and helps finance his recording career. Her initial enthusiasm turns into possessive behavior as she tries to control his success. Her character illustrates the darker side of fame and obsession, culminating in a dramatic crisis that reveals the emotional toll of pursuing stardom.
Gujral is the powerful businessman who funds Arjun's recording project. He represents the commercial machinery of the music industry, the money, influence, and investment behind creating stars. His involvement shows how the entertainment business operates and the wealthy interests that shape an artist's path to fame.
The film has a bittersweet tone, Arjun achieves his dream of becoming a famous singer, but his success comes at a personal cost. A friend's emotional crisis creates tragedy amid the celebration of his achievements. The movie blends uplifting musical moments with serious themes of obsession and mental health, creating an emotional mix of joy and sadness.
